Robert Brent Obituary

Robert A. Brent (Bob), age 93, lovingly called "the Ranger" by some, passed away March 17, 2024 in Pewee Valley KY. Born in Campbellsburg KY to Dewey and Louise Brent, Bob graduated from Bowling Green Business University where he met his wife of 64 years, Dorothy Rogers (deceased in 2015). Bob had a long successful career with General Electric in purchasing until retirement in 1990, which began in Owensboro KY upon graduation and brought the family to Louisville in 1970. Bob loved his God, Family and Country. He was a devoted member of Crestwood Methodist Church and served on the board of directors for many years for the Kavanaugh Life Enrichment Center. He cherished his family farm shared with his brothers and nephew that he considered to be "heaven on earth". He enjoyed trips to the farm and looking over his cattle right up until his death. Bob loved to fish and he loved working at his church fish fry for many years. He also enjoyed bird hunting with his brothers and friends. He had a passion for history, heritage, and ancestry. For many years, Bob joined in coffee companionship with a group of friends he called his "Liar's Club" at Crestwood Dairy Queen. He was very patriotic and held the highest respect for those that served our country, He was a member of Sons of American Revolution-Isaac Shelby Chapter, proudly receiving his 20 year pin just before his death. 

Preceded in death by his brother Don Brent, left to cherish him in memories are his brother Jerry (Mary Ann) Brent, sister Lucy Belle Forbes, daughters Bonnie Tuggle, Jill Kelley (Bruce Hinson), and Amy (Jeff) Walter, along with three grandchildren Shawna (Rich) Lasky, Lucas (Stacie) Tuggle, Kelly (Frank) McAllister, nine great-grandchildren, three nieces and nephew, and his best buddy, cat Sam.
